Election Day, “Adopt a Poll”

On Election Day (Tuesday, November 8th, 2011), the Freedom Forum participated in the “Adopt-a-Poll” program sponsored by the Stanislaus County Clerk Recorders Office.  Club members volunteered as poll workers for the day.  The precinct was at Standiford Place, and this activity helped raise money for scholarships.

Modesto Mayoral Candidates Forum

The Freedom Forum and the ASMJC Political Development Committee co-hosted the Modesto Mayoral Candidates Forum on Wednesday, September 28th, 2011.  The forum was a great event and very successful in educating attendees on the candidates’ positions.  All four mayoral candidates participated.  The candidates were Brad Hawn, Armando Arreola, Bill Zoslocki, and Garrad Marsh.  The Freedom [...]

Voter Registration Booth at Ceres Fair

The Freedom Forum had a voter registration booth at a fair sponsored by the Social Workers of Northern Central Valley Network.  The fair was held at Central Valley High School in Ceres on Saturday, August 6th 2011 from 3:00pm-7:00pm.
